    You can spend the whole day here with the kids which makes it great VFM. You can take your own food or buy there. There is something for all ages - our group ranged from 5yrs to 13yrs. Bouncy pillows, pedal go carts, 2 mazes, farm animals, sandpit, birds of prey, indoor play centre, outdoor play areas…and so much more!

    Brilliant place for a childrens day out. Has a very wide range of activities that will easily entertain a child for a full day. Lots of animal sheds with well cared for animals, stalls for archery football and crafts, great games including hog splash, tractor rides and play park. Also two great mazes. Lots of shows which the staff deliver and engage people with humour and professionalism. The staff are so helpful and friendly. Food in the cafe is good. All round recommended.
